Lost/stolen iphone - how to log out of Hotmail remotely

My iPhone has been stolen and I am concerned because there is a browser window open and logged in to Hotmail. 


How can I log out of all Hotmail sessions, thereby closing the one on the iPhone remotely? 

There is also a quick link to email on the homepage of the iPhone, but I have changed the Hotmail password which I believe stops this working, whereas the browser window stays logged in even after the password has been changed. 

I have found advice elsewhere that says you can log out of all sessions by going to "options", "personal", but I cannot find these options on my Hotmail.
